GeoLookup
GeoLookup
Statue of Peter I of Serbia in Novi Sad
Worldchevron_rightSerbiachevron_rightStatue of Peter I of Serbia in Novi Sad

Statue of Peter I of Serbia in Novi Sadverified

No description available.